WHAT IS ELENLOND?

Elenlond is an original free-form medieval fantasy RPG set on the continent of Soare and the Scattered Isles, which are located to the south in the Sea of Diverging Waters. The four chief nations of the western side of the world—Ashoka in northern Soare, Soto in western Soare, Morrim in eastern Soare, and Angkar, the largest of the Scattered Isles—continue to experience growth and prosperity since the fall of the Mianorite gods, although power struggles within the countries—or outside of them—continue to ensue.

    Name – Anna Chronos
    Age – Appears 27, actually 35 (slowed aging)
    Gender – Female
    Alignment – Chaotic, Good (though fiercely loyal)
    Social Class – Literally not from around here, Street Rat?
    Occupation – None Currently. Formerly a (failed) time traveler and Soldier
    Race – Scion(see below)
    Equipment – Tangat (large kukri), Bastard Sword, Buckler, Breastplate, Silk Clothing

    Physical Appearance – Anna stands at a surprising 6’3; tall for a woman, with a lithe, yet muscular build. She has long blonde hair, and blue eyes, with flowing garments. Her overall color scheme seems to be blue, silver and white. She wears a breastplate, probably made out of Mithril, along with legplates and a shoulderguard of the same material. She also wears mithril-plate gloves to protect her hands during combat, as any intelligent swordsman knows is required.

    She carries at her side a rather large sword, with yet another crossing her back. She wears, on her right hand, a buckler. She has pierced cartilage on both ears, upon close examination, plain silver studs. She talks with a rather unusual accent.

    Personality – Anna can be snarky, and witty, usually choosing to follow intuition over judgment. She tends to be exceptionally knowledgable, though given where she's from, a sizable portion of her knowledge no longer applies. Anna greatly enjoys company, and would prefer to chat to being silent. She is brash and often taunts opponents during combat.

    In addition to all these things, Anna is fiercely against slavery, having been a slave herself... though she's not stupid, she'll find a way to fight the system, without getting herself killed, if possible. She also sees being locked up as being the equivalent to one of the worst fates imaginable... her punishment for breaking orders was generally being locked up until she was bored to tears. She has mild Claustrophobia and does -not- do well with being bound, as a result.

    History – Anna Chronos hails from a land called Runeterra, it is there where she was born... cloned from an alternate reality's version of herself, with the purpose of one day being given a spark of divinity to help to reforge the ranks of the Pantheon and help to reforge the world away from the broken plane of existence that it had become.

    It was there that she studied her abilities, something slightly beyond human to begin with, though with a dash of paradox, and an intimate familiarity with time magic. Due to the lack of available resources on her magic of choice, she took to learning about the other magics, tuning their patterns to use with her temporal energy to create effects where and when she could.

    Growing up, she also trained under a man named Tekun, who used massively oversized weapons... she likewise learned to use oversized onehanded weapons from him, as she grew. She fought alongside the Preservers of Valoran to defend her world from an outside threat known as the void... and later to defend against an inside threat known as the one-masked demon. The One-masked Demon nearly spelled her demise, were it not for her fate, who stepped in, allowing her to escape.

    Due to this overstep of her Fate's abilities, the god of Fate sentenced it to death... which would spell the end of Anna Chronos. Areia, a master strategist, moved her pawn into place... sacrificing Anna's freedom as an Avatar of Fate to put the young woman into the hands of Fate. He would protect her, until she was needed, and she would be of use to him until that time.

    After countless years of slavery, tying up Fate's loose ends, Anna was selected to complete a duty she had already completed once: Go back in time and give vital information to help prevent the Preservers from losing any largescale battles... and more importantly, make the heads of their enemy question each other's abilities and motives.

    That's where everything went wrong. Anna took the device in hand which had been designed to send her to the exact time and place she would be needed... and immediately vanished in a spark of void lightning... she was ripped away to a different time and place. She was deposited into a land called Soare.

    Soare is vitally different from Runeterra... basic laws of physics are different. Gravity is heavier, magic doesn't work the same way... even time flows in a different pattern, and thus Anna, a seasoned warrior, is forced to relearn all of her old tricks, from the ground up. Assuming she even can. And she so badly needs to go home to complete her mission... and so she will learn, and grow, and adapt, until she can leave this world behind.

    Race: Anna's Race is effectively a modified human. She ages slowly, by comparison, and also carries a bit of paradox in her body(she's missing a bit of divine spark), along with her 'mana' being raw temporal energy. She is literally a clone of herself from an alternate timeline.
